    How to Buy Clothes Online From the UK

    The UK has a variety of fashion brands, ranging from fashionable womenswear to elegant male clothing. Selfridges, Harrods and other famous department stores are located in the UK.

    However, grazhdanstvo-russia.ru buying clothes from UK retailers can be tricky for people who are not from the country. Many stores have shipping restrictions which make it difficult to purchase their clothing internationally.

    Matalan is a leading UK and international omnichannel retailer, providing high-quality and value for the whole family. Their merchandise includes clothing for women, men, and children as well as furniture and homeware. They have 230 UK stores, and 49 International Franchises in Europe as well as the Middle East, and Africa. They offer late-night openings, convenient parking, and a convenient click-and-collect service. The brand offers a range of styles that can be a perfect match for any wardrobe. From basic pieces to statement pieces, the brand offers something for everyone.

    Another option for buying clothes is John Lewis, a huge department store that is renowned around the world for its high-quality clothing from brands like Whistles, Joules and Barbour, as well as an extensive selection of other goods such as electronics, beauty and baby formula. Although the store offers some international shipping options you should be aware that their 'Never knowingly undersold price guarantee is only applicable to UK orders and not international.

    Marks and Spencer

    Marks and Spencer, known colloquially as M&S or Marks and Sparks, is a British retailer that sells clothing and food products. The company has more than a thousand stores worldwide and employs around 35,000 people. It is a major player in the retail sector and is headquartered in the City of London, UK.

    The company offers more than just clothing. They also offer food, flowers and other gifts. They have a variety of merchandise at reasonable prices. The store is renowned for its high-quality products and great customer service. The staff is always available to answer questions and help customers.

    Another option to shop for clothes online is to use a parcel forwarding service like Forward2me. These services give you an UK shipping address and can take your orders from a variety of websites and send them to you in one package. This is a great solution for expats or those who want to avoid the restrictions on shipping that a lot of UK-based websites have.

    Lastly, if you're looking to purchase clothes from the UK but don't live in the UK, you can use an online platform like Jetkrate. This will give you an unique UK address that you can use to shop at every retailer. The company will keep your purchases in storage until they are able to ship them to you. This service is ideal for people who are moving to the UK or for those who do not have a family member or friend in the country.

    Many of the top UK clothing brands offer an online store, from high street heroes like Zara and H&M to designer fashion stores such as Net-A-Porter and Matches Fashion. Some retailers, including John Lewis and Debenhams, offer beauty, homeware lighting, garden and home products as well as fashion.
